After daring myself to join a dating app, my next step was to land a date. No small thing I realize in hindsight.

It took me three months from joining the app to get from a match, step one, to a date in the real world, yet another step. Steps in between involved a brief chatting of very small talk via text, sprinkled with emojis. Then later a long(ish) phone call.

I had something to prove. To myself, my ex, my future boyfriend.

I wanted to show up for myself, I had something to prove. I needed to know that I could do it. Then something unexpected happened, I noticed that I was feeling excited. Interesting.

Did this mean that I had a crush? Did I like this strange new person? Or was I just awakening myself to the potential for love, and that was what made me tingle?

So I showed up. I did the date. I put in effort. I may have even flirted, granted so rustily I had to point out my jokes…And I had fun. No kissing. No major sparks. No red flags. But easy conversation. A good evening.

Isn’t that what a date should be?
